For example, look at the Overview of ICOM, first paragraph:


> ICOM specification defines a class called Entity which is the super
> class of any class that supports a persistent identifier, a change
> token for optimistic locking, and an access control list. The object
> identifier and change token are annotated, respectively, by
> “javax.persistence.Id” and “javax.persistence.Version,” matching the
> ICOM concept of Entity with the JPA concept of Entity. ICOM Entity has
> an extra dimension for access control list, which together with JPA Id
> and Version, defines a unit of persistent information for concurrency
> and access control. The generation of object identifiers is
> implementation dependent; however, ICOM recommends that the object
> identifiers should be globally unique to support permanent references
> to the entities that may migrate amongst interoperable ICOM
> repositories. An object identifier is read only (immutable) once it is
> assigned and should never be duplicated or re-used for more than one
> object. The UML diagram in Figure 2 depicts the Entity class,
> properties, and cardinality of the properties. Entity’s properties
> include name, created by, creation date, last modified by, last
> modification date, owner, parent, attached markers, category
> applications, tag applications, and access control list.

> Here we explain the usage of each of the properties of Entity shown in
> Figure 2. ICOM relies on object identifier for persistent
> identification of an entity and allows the name string of the entity
> as an optional property. The actor who creates an entity is
> represented by the created by attribute. The created by and creation
> date attributes are set by the system and cannot be changed once they
> are set, hence created by and creation date are read-only attributes
> for applications. The last modified by and last modification date
> attributes can be updated by applications although ordinarily these
> attributes should be set by the system. The owner of an entity can be
> either a single actor or a group of actors.
